#5c611c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5c611c is composed of 36.1% red, 38%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.1%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 64.3 degrees, a saturation of 55.2% and a lightness of 24.5%. #5c611c color hex could be obtained by blending #b8c238 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#5c611c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050602 is the darkest color, while #fcfc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5c611c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f3f3e is the less saturated color, while #717904 is the most saturated one.
